**Ticket: Font vendoring drift on GlyphCart**

On-call: heads up. The vendored third-party fonts in GlyphCart's asset pipeline have drifted from the lockfile — prod is serving two typefaces at versions we never approved, likely from Denna's emergency cache rebuild last month. This breaks reproducible builds and our license audit for the Marwick storefront. Don't re-run the fetch script until the pin list is fixed; it'll pull newer versions and make it worse. The pipeline's current live configuration is as follows.

service settings:
[casax]
port = 6379
team = rusir
host = casax.zemvarhq.corp
region = outer-4
access_code = ac_9808ce
timeout_ms = 1500

**Alert: shrinkbatch CLI — elevated failure rate**

The shrinkbatch image-resizing CLI has exceeded its failure threshold over the last three runs. Typical causes are malformed source manifests, exhausted scratch disk on the worker pool, or an expired toolchain cache. Check the run logs in the Pindle dashboard, clear the cache if timestamps look stale, and retry the smallest failing batch first. If failures continue after one retry cycle, page the Tooling team via the address below.

billing contact of yawip-yadup = druath.casdor@nelvrolabs.internal

# Service Accounts — Fennelcache

The bloom filter sitting in front of the Kivi key-value store runs under the `fennel-sentry` service account. If you're on call and the false-positive rate spikes, you'll need to query its admin endpoint directly. It authenticates with a static key, which for convenience is pasted here.

service key, yadug-bajog: zpat3_pou

Heads up: the Coinrake payroll export switched from fixed-width to delimited format this cycle. If the bank gateway rejects the file, it's almost always a lingering fixed-width template on one of the export workers — restart them and regenerate. Don't hand-edit the file; finance will bounce it. Format spec and regeneration steps are on the page below.

runbook for badug-kadup: https://confluence.zemvarlabs.internal/projects/browse/display/projects/bd1b